PRESIDENT AOUN TACKLES WORK OF MINISTERIAL COMMITTEE IN CHARGE OF NEGOTIATING WITH IMF WITH DEPUTY PRIME MINISTER

President of the Republic, General Michel Aoun, met Deputy Prime Minister, Saada Al-Shami, today at the Presidential Palace.

The meeting addressed the work of the Ministerial Committee in charge of negotiating with the International Monetary Fund, and the ongoing preparations for this purpose.

Al-Shami explained that after the formation of the committee, a series of preparatory meetings were held, expressing hope that it would quickly complete its work to start negotiations with the International Monetary Fund soon, according to the desire of the President of the Republic, the Prime Minister and the members of the committee.

Archbishop George Khawam

The President met Archbishop George Khawam, who is elected to the Diocese of Lattakia, Tartous and their Melkite Greek Catholic dependencies, accompanied by Dr. Suhail Abu Hala.

Archbishop Khawam invited President Aoun to attend his bishop’s ordination on Saturday, October 16, at St. Paul’s Church in Harissa, headed by the Roman Catholic Patriarch Youssef Al-Absi.

For his side, President Aoun wished Archbishop Khawam success in his new spiritual responsibilities.
